Story summary
- King Charles III will address a joint meeting of the U.S. Congress, the second monarch to do so.
- President Donald Trump will host the king and Queen Camilla in Washington, D.C., April 27-30, 2026.
- Trump told the BBC the visit could repair U.S.–U.K. relations and called Charles ‘fantastic’.
- The itinerary includes a White House arrival with a 21-gun salute, an Oval Office meeting, a state dinner and stops in New York and Virginia.
